Output 51c33e6a984dfff2783906af59eca9cc9cd9cc80d4bb63f71efc34e29a147a92:0

value
30000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5d8b53e04e72eea26d1b1a4db02d52344bd4c95 OP_EQUAL
address
3JGXqQ7YBemvZNBuk3vJ6oyDku5L48oXYk
transaction
51c33e6a984dfff2783906af59eca9cc9cd9cc80d4bb63f71efc34e29a147a92
spent
true